Wigan vs Barnsley Predictions

Both teams can strike at Wigan

Take both teams to get a goal in Saturday’s League One clash between Wigan and Barnsley at the Brick Community Stadium. Both sides have scored in 24 of Barnsley’s 38 league matches this season, and in four of their last six games.

Barnsley are 11th in League One, seven places and ten points above Wigan, with the hosts sitting 18th having won 11 and lost 15 of their 36 games this season, while the visitors have won 15 and lost 15.

It’s hard to draw many conclusions from Wigan’s recent League One results, with two wins, two draws and two defeats in their last six outings. Three weeks ago they were 1-0 winners over Cambridge in their last home game.

Barnsley’s last two road trips have both ended in defeat and these are tough times for them, with three of their last four matches ending in defeat.

Barnsley dominated possession in their 1-1 draw with Cambridge last weekend, having 74.2% of the ball, and it was a surprise that they didn’t win, having been priced at 8/11.

This was Barnsley’s fourth game in six with both teams scoring and means they have failed to win eight of the 11 times they have been odds-on this season.

They created chances and hit the woodwork but were unable to force a winner.
